“…Among the hormones, thyroxine induces hepatic biosynthesis of CoQ and may be responsible for the elevated level of this lipid in the livers of rodents maintained at 4°C for 10 days (36, 37). Furthermore, both vitamin A deficiency and inhibition of squalene synthase by squalestatin 1 lead to elevated levels of CoQ in both cultured cells and rats (38,39).…”

“…SQ is a well known inhibitor of squalene synthase activity in mammalian cells (32)(33)(34)(35)(36), and preliminary reports indicate that it is an effective inhibitor of this enzyme in plants (37). Tobacco squalene synthase activity was found to be strongly inhibited at subnanomolar concentrations of SQ (Fig.…”

“…To further prove lovastatin's inhibitory effect to be due to cholesterol lowering, squalestatin 1, an inhibitor of the squalene synthase, was also tested for its effect on signal transduction via GPI-anchored proteins. Squalestatin 1 blocks cholesterol biosynthesis at a step distal to mevalonate synthesis and, therefore, does not affect side products of the mevalonate pathway (45). Squalestatin 1 inhibited signal transduction via CD59 similarly to lovastatin (47 Ϯ 14% inhibition; Fig.…”
